Healthy Quinoa Enchilada Bake
Cheesy enchilada flavor without the roll-ups — quinoa, black beans, and chicken bake in one dish with a lighter Greek yogurt enchilada sauce.
Prep 15 min
Cook 35 min
Total 50 min
Serves 6
Ingredients
Step 1 — Cook the quinoa
- 1 cup quinoa (rinsed)
- 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
Step 2 — Make the filling
- 1 lb cooked chicken (shredded)
- 1 can (15 oz) black beans (rinsed)
- 1 cup corn (fresh or frozen)
- 1 cup enchilada sauce (low sodium)
- 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 tsp chili powder
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
Step 3 — Assemble and bake
- 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ese
- Fresh cilantro
- Lime wedges
Instructions
- 1
Cook the quinoa
Preheat oven to 375°F. Cook quinoa in broth according to package directions until fluffy. Spread in a greased 9x13 baking dish.
- 2
Make the filling
In a large bowl, combine chicken, black beans, corn, half the enchilada sauce, Greek yogurt, cumin, chili powder,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Spread over quinoa and stir gently to combine.
- 3
Assemble and bake
Pour remaining enchilada sauce over the top. Sprinkle with cheese. Bake 25 minutes until bubbly. Rest 5 minutes. Top with cilantro and serve with lime wedges.
Nutrition per serving: 380 cal · 34g protein · 36g carbs · 12g fat · 7g fiber
